WebJul 27, 2016 · The main benefit to a rolling release model is the ability for the end user to use the newest features the developer has enabled. For example, one of the newer features of the Linux kernel, introduced with the 4.0 update, was the ability to update the kernel without restarting your computer. A fixed release distro is a distribution that’s being released regularly every few months. It contains heavily tested and verified software packages, ensuring everything is stable and “everything just works.”
